Depression at Baseline Is an Independent Risk Factor for Cognitive Decline in Patients on Peritoneal Dialysis: A
Xue-Dan Nie1, Qin Wang2, Yu-Hui Zhang3
1Department of Neurology, The Second Affiliated Hospital of Harbin Medical University, Heilongjiang, China.
Depression significantly worsens cognitive decline in peritoneal dialysis (PD) patients. Moderate to severe depression predicts a decline in global cognitive function and memory over two years.

Background:
- Depression is a known risk factor for cognitive impairment (CI).
- Previous studies linking depression and CI primarily used cross-sectional data.
- The impact of depression on cognitive decline in peritoneal dialysis (PD) patients requires further prospective investigation.
Purpose of the Study:
- To prospectively investigate the association between depression and cognitive decline in PD patients.
- To assess the impact of baseline depression severity on cognitive function over a 2-year period.
- To identify depression as a predictor of cognitive decline in this population.
Main Methods:
- A multicenter prospective cohort study involving 458 PD patients over 2 years.
- Cognitive function assessed using the Modified Mini-Mental State Examination (3MS) for global cognition, Trail-Making Tests for executive function, and the Battery for the Assessment of Neuropsychological Status for memory, visuospatial skills, and language.
- Depression assessed using Zung's Self-Rating Depression Scale.
Main Results:
- Patients with moderate/severe depression showed a significant decline in global cognitive function over 2 years (p=0.008).
- Patients without depression maintained stable global cognitive function and showed improvements in memory, visuospatial skills, and language.
- Baseline depression was a significant predictor of worsening global cognitive function (OR=-0.14, p=0.031) and decline in memory and language skills.
Conclusions:
- Depression is a significant risk factor for cognitive decline in PD patients.
- Severity of depression correlates with the degree of cognitive impairment.
- Early detection and management of depression may be crucial for preserving cognitive function in PD patients.
